技术速递|为 GitHub Copilot 构建智能体记忆系统

技术速递|为 GitHub Copilot 构建智能体记忆系统

💡 原文中文,约4900字,阅读约需12分钟。
📝

内容提要

GitHub Copilot推出跨智能体记忆系统,提升编码、审查和调试效率。该系统允许智能体基于经验记忆,无需用户指示,增强协作能力。记忆功能默认关闭,用户可自主启用,确保隐私安全。通过实时验证,智能体能有效管理和更新记忆,提升开发者工作流效率。

🎯

关键要点

  • GitHub Copilot推出跨智能体记忆系统,提升编码、审查和调试效率。
  • 该系统允许智能体基于经验记忆,无需用户指示,增强协作能力。
  • 记忆功能默认关闭,用户可自主启用,确保隐私安全。
  • 智能体通过实时验证有效管理和更新记忆,提升开发者工作流效率。
  • 记忆系统的核心挑战在于确保存储的知识在代码演变过程中仍然有效。
  • 使用实时验证避免过时或误导信息的风险,确保信息的准确性。
  • 记忆创建作为工具调用,智能体在执行任务时存储值得记住的学习内容。
  • 记忆的使用通过检索目标仓库中最新的记忆来提升智能体的效率。
  • 记忆具有严格的作用范围,确保隐私和安全。
  • 跨智能体记忆共享使不同智能体之间能够相互学习和应用知识。
  • 评估智能体韧性,确保系统能够处理过时或错误的记忆。
  • 记忆系统在开发者日常工作流中带来了可衡量的价值,提升了合并率和反馈率。
  • 未来将继续优化记忆的生成、整理和使用,推动Copilot的演进。

延伸问答

GitHub Copilot的跨智能体记忆系统有什么主要功能?

该系统提升编码、审查和调试效率,允许智能体基于经验记忆,无需用户指示,增强协作能力。

用户如何启用GitHub Copilot的记忆功能?

记忆功能默认关闭,用户可以在GitHub Copilot设置中自主启用。

GitHub Copilot的记忆系统如何确保信息的准确性?

通过实时验证,智能体在使用记忆前确认信息在当前分支中仍然准确且相关。

跨智能体记忆共享有什么优势?

不同智能体之间能够相互学习和应用知识,提高整体工作效率。

记忆系统在开发者工作流中带来了哪些具体价值?

记忆系统使拉取请求合并率提升7%,评论的正向反馈率提升2%,提高了开发效率和代码质量。

GitHub Copilot的记忆系统面临哪些挑战?

核心挑战在于确保存储的知识在代码演变过程中仍然有效,处理代码变更和冲突。

➡️

继续阅读